Key Takeaways

Prioritize understanding your financial statements, including job costing and break-even analysis, to set accurate pricing and ensure profitability.

Resist the urge to discount; instead, strategically raise your prices by 5-10% to significantly increase profit margins without needing a proportional increase in sales volume.

Develop a strong lead generation system and refine your sales process as the owner before hiring sales reps to ensure efficient growth and better training.

Maximize every job by actively seeking additional sales in the same neighborhood where you're already working, reducing customer acquisition costs.

Implement a comprehensive pre-selling strategy, including personalized videos and testimonials, to improve your close rate and build trust before appointments.

Always answer your phone with a live, professional person to capture leads immediately and prevent potential customers from going to competitors.

Establish clear production processes and communication protocols to protect job profitability and ensure a 5-star customer experience, preventing common communication screw-ups.
